Defining the Transition to Local Terms
Localization (Phase-out) is a compensation strategy for expatriate employees. It involves systematically reducing international allowances, such as housing and cost of living adjustments, over a set period, typically 2 to 3 years. The ultimate goal is to transition the employee from a premium expat package to a standard local salary and benefits package, aligning them with the host country's pay structure for long term assignments.
Why Global Mobility is a High Stakes Game
For hiring managers, managing a localization plan is a delicate balancing act. You need to attract top international talent with competitive packages while managing long term payroll costs and ensuring fairness with local employees. The biggest challenge is communicating this complex, multi-year transition with total clarity during the hiring process. Any misstep can lead to mismatched expectations, difficult negotiations, and early employee turnover, derailing a critical international assignment and wasting significant resources.
